How does scientific knowledge grow?

Scientific knowledge grows through a systematic process of observation, experimentation, and peer review. Researchers formulate hypotheses, conduct experiments to test these ideas, and analyze the results. Successful findings are published and scrutinized by the scientific community, leading to further experimentation and refinement of theories. This iterative process allows for the accumulation of knowledge and the correction of inaccuracies, driving scientific progress.

What is the difference between scientific investigation and scientific knowledge?

Scientific investigation refers to the systematic process of exploring and studying natural phenomena through observation, experimentation, and analysis to answer specific questions or test hypotheses. In contrast, scientific knowledge is the body of information and understanding that results from these investigations, encompassing theories, laws, and established facts about the natural world. Essentially, scientific investigation is the method, while scientific knowledge is the outcome.
